Infineon TLE4254GS Series Linear Voltage Regulator, -20V Minimum Input Voltage, 45V Maximum Input Voltage - TLE4254GSXUMA4
This linear voltage regulator provides regulated supply functionality for automotive and industrial systems operating across a wide input range. It is designed as a surface-mounted solution in an 8-pin package, offering low-power standby behaviour and suitability for high-temperature environments encountered in vehicle electronics.
Features and Benefits:
• Input tolerance from -20V to 45V enables wide-range protection
• Quiescent current of 5μA minimises standby power drain
• Tested to automotive AEC-Q100 standard supports vehicle applications
• RoHS compliance ensures restricted-substance adherence
• Rated for operation up to 150°C sustains elevated thermal conditions
• Surface mount PG-DSO-8 package simplifies automated assembly

What packaging format does it use for board mounting?
It is supplied in a PG-DSO-8 surface-mount package with eight pins for standard PCB placement and solder-reflow assembly.
How does it behave thermally during prolonged high-load operation?
The device is specified to operate up to 150°C, allowing continuous use in elevated ambient temperatures typical of engine-bay installations.
What electrical environments can it tolerate on the input?
The regulator accepts input voltages down to -20V and up to 45V, accommodating transients and reverse-polarity scenarios seen in automotive systems.
How does it impact system standby energy consumption?
With a quiescent current of 5μA, it keeps idle power draw to a minimum, preserving battery life in low-activity states.
